To write a persuasive essay for a school prefect position, focus on highlighting your leadership qualities, experiences, and why you are the best candidate for the role. Make sure to include specific examples of how you have demonstrated leadership in the past, how you plan to contribute to the school community as a prefect, and how your skills align with the responsibilities of the position. Structure your essay with a strong introduction, clear arguments supporting your candidacy, and a compelling conclusion that reinforces your suitability for the role.

Q: How do you write a persuasive essay for school prefect position?

What is the major difference between a persuasive essay and an argumentative essay?

The major difference between a persuasive essay and an argumentative essay is in their purpose and tone. A persuasive essay aims to convince the reader to take a certain position or action, while an argumentative essay presents both sides of an issue and argues for one side over the other. Persuasive essays often use emotional appeals, while argumentative essays rely more on logical reasoning and evidence.


What must the first paragraph of a persuasive research essay include?

The first paragraph of a persuasive research essay should introduce the topic and provide background information. It should also clearly state the thesis statement, which outlines the main argument or position that the essay will be defending. Additionally, the first paragraph should grab the reader's attention and set the tone for the rest of the essay.


What is a characteristic of a call to action in a persuasive essay?

A characteristic of a call to action in a persuasive essay is that it is clear and direct, providing a specific action for the reader to take. It should be compelling and persuasive, motivating the reader to act on the information presented in the essay.


Why is it important to choose compelling evidence for a persuasive essay?

Selecting compelling evidence for a persuasive essay is important because it strengthens your argument and helps to persuade your audience to see your point of view. Strong evidence can make your essay more credible and convincing, leading to a more successful persuasive piece. By presenting solid evidence, you can build trust with your readers and increase the likelihood of them accepting your position.
